Select Nikos Kazantzakis Quotations:
I expect nothing. I fear no one. I am free.
Nikos Kazantzakis
In order to succeed, we must first believe that we can.
Nikos Kazantzakis
A person needs a little madness, or else they never dare cut the rope and be free.
Nikos Kazantzakis
There is only one woman in the world. One woman, with many faces.
Nikos Kazantzakis
I hope for nothing. I fear nothing. I am free.
Nikos Kazantzakis
I said to the almond tree, "Friend, speak to me of God," and the almond tree blossomed.
Nikos Kazantzakis
